If you’re a CT Tech curious about Travel job trends in Media, PA,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 6 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,494 and a range from $2,242 to $2,710 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.
Positions were located in key zip codes, including 19063.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led CT Techs in Media’s thriving healthcare landscape. Candidates seeking a Computed Tomography Technology travel job in Media, Pennsylvania, typically need to have a registered radiologic technologist certification along with specialized training in CT imaging. Previous experience in a clinical setting is often preferred, as it demonstrates both technical proficiency and the ability to adapt to various healthcare environments.
Computed Tomography Technology travel jobs in Media, Pennsylvania are typically found in hospitals, imaging centers, and outpatient diagnostic facilities. These settings provide a variety of medical imaging services where CT technologists are essential for patient care.
For Computed Tomography Technology Travel jobs in Media, PA, typical contract durations range from 9-12 weeks, 13 weeks, and 14-26 weeks. These flexible contract lengths allow you to choose an assignment that best fits your career goals and lifestyle preferences.
